B: Tuohy Jamison White
HB: Walker Henderson Gibbs

Foll: Kruezer Judd Curnow
C: Scotland McLean Bootsma

HF: Yarran Casboult Armfield
F: Garlett Waite Murphy

Int: Robinson Cachia Bell (Simpson)


IMO our best balanced line up this year! It's now about attitude.

One ruck supported by a forward/ruck. Kruezer will dominate being No.1 and doing 80% of game time on ball. That is his best spot by a mile.

Better balanced and skilful forward structure that should be very good defensively.

Back 6 plus 1 is really starting to look solid and with Walker/Gibbs can provide some real drive. Still the option of Yarran to drop back at times releasing Gibbs onto ball.

Really like to see Bootsma play a full game on a wing pushing forward/back.

Only issue I have is with leg speed through the middle and we don't even have Ellard and Carrazzo available. Lot of similarity and lack of genuine A grade class. With Menzel, Buckley, Graham coming through and Lucas & Betts to come back that will hopefully change.

Blues by 88.
